Ticket Availability and Broadcast Access
Securing tickets for Fever vs. Wings games requires a strategic approach as venues frequently sell out within hours of a major playoff-seeding announcement. For those unable to attend in person, the accessibility of the games has never been higher.
Tips for securing the best value:
- Official Team Portals: Always check the primary team websites first to avoid inflated service fees found on third-party resale platforms.
- Dynamic Pricing: Be aware that ticket prices fluctuate based on real-time team performance and star-player availability.
- Verified Resale Markets: Use only reputable platforms like Ticketmaster’s verified exchange to ensure authenticity.
- Broadcast Options: If you are watching remotely, WNBA League Pass remains the most reliable source for out-of-market games, while national networks cover marquee dates.
The shift toward mobile-only ticketing has streamlined entry processes, but fans are urged to download their tickets to their digital wallets at least 24 hours prior to tip-off to avoid connectivity issues at the arena gates.
